Output 93c4b2a94c4d3813fd802767c09fc882858e40180afbb3ded3d62ac28f6318e5:1

value
3032676771
script pubkey
OP_0 OP_PUSHBYTES_20 963945f00a6eb5b45f37a341b7c8a75cf9f96780
address
tb1qjcu5tuq2d66mgheh5dqm0j98tnuljeuqguggc5
transaction
93c4b2a94c4d3813fd802767c09fc882858e40180afbb3ded3d62ac28f6318e5
confirmations
59561
spent
true